Nuvision CU celebrates grand opening of new Mesa-Longbow branch

Credit union welcomes members, community partners, and city and civic leaders to grand opening of state-of-the-art branch.

Continuing its commitment to — and investment in — the local communities it serves, Nuvision Credit Union today celebrated the grand opening of its new full-service Mesa-Longbow, AZ branch with a ribbon cutting ceremony.

The credit union welcomed more than 50 members, local officials and community leaders to the ceremony, including Mesa Chamber of Commerce’s CEO, Sally Harrison and Membership Director, Susan Tychman, City of Mesa Councilmember Alicia Goforth, and Kristin Sorensen, Senior Community & Government Relations Specialist for The Boeing Company.

The event included lunch, tours of the state-of-the-art branch and member experience, and a meet and greet with Nuvision’s CEO, Roger Ballard, members of the Nuvision executive leadership team, and Mesa branch staff.

The new branch, located at 5822 E. Longbow Pkwy., Ste 101, Mesa, marks an important milestone in the credit union’s expansion in Arizona and its continued commitment to serving the region. Nuvision has been a part of the Mesa community for 40 years, beginning with its first branch serving Boeing employees, its current Boeing campus branch, which opened in 2004, and now the new state-of-the-art Mesa-Longbow branch.

The state-of-the art facility offers convenient access to in-person banking, new ITMs (ATMs) providing personalized touch of a live teller, as well as comprehensive digital and mobile services to better serve our members’ needs.

Beyond serving members’ financial needs, the credit union is deeply committed to the communities it serves. Nuvision has a 90-year history of giving back to its communities, delivering meaningful impact through a variety of initiatives centered on helping youth and families, advancing financial literacy, honoring veterans and first responders, and supporting local nonprofits. In 2025 alone, Nuvision participated in/hosted 100 community events across the 5 states it serves, with more than 600 team members volunteering over 1,500 hours in local communities.

During the event, Nuvision recognized two valued Mesa-based community partners, non-profit Paz De Cristo Community Center and VFW Post 1760 – Mesa, with a check presentation ceremony, supporting each organization’s efforts in helping the community.

“We are excited to be expanding our presence in Mesa, and in Arizona, with a new location that will allow us to better serve our members and our community,” noted Roger Ballard, Nuvision’s CEO. “We look forward to helping our members live a healthy financial lifestyle and reach their financial goals by providing an exceptional banking experience and services that meet them where they are in their financial wellness journey.”
